I enjoyed this book. I loved the structure, with each chapter switching between residents of The Avenue as they recover from one war and are drawn into another. I wish there were fewer characters with 'E' names (I sometimes had to take a few seconds to remember which one Esme/Edgar/Esther/Elaine/Edith/Eunice/Eugene was) and struggled with some of the phonetically written accents, but overall I liked the characters and their various facets of 1930's Britishness - would have liked a flapper though!
